Understanding SSH Keys and Their Importance
So, what’s the deal with SSH keys? Think of them as a digital keycard that grants you access to your Raspberry Pi. Without one, you'd have to rely on passwords, which can be risky if someone gets their hands on yours. SSH keys provide a much more secure way to authenticate your identity, ensuring that only you can access your device.
Setting up an SSH key might sound intimidating, but trust me, it’s easier than you think. Plus, once it’s done, you’ll never have to worry about forgetting passwords again. Your SSH key becomes your trusty sidekick, keeping your Raspberry Pi secure and accessible whenever you need it.
How to Generate an SSH Key for Your Raspberry Pi
Generating an SSH key is a breeze. Here’s a quick step-by-step guide to get you started:
- Open your terminal and type
ssh-keygen -t rsa -b 4096
. This command generates a new SSH key pair. - When prompted, hit Enter to save the key in the default location.
- Next, you’ll be asked to enter a passphrase. This adds an extra layer of security to your key. Make sure it’s something you can remember easily.
- Once the key is generated, you can find it in the
~/.ssh
directory.
Voila! You now have your very own SSH key ready to be used with the RemoteIoT platform.
Setting Up RemoteIoT with Your Raspberry Pi
Now that you’ve got your SSH key, it’s time to set up the RemoteIoT platform on your Raspberry Pi. Follow these simple steps to get started:
- Install RemoteIoT: Head over to the official RemoteIoT website and download the installation package for your Raspberry Pi.
- Configure SSH: Enable SSH on your Raspberry Pi by running
sudo raspi-config
and navigating to the SSH option. - Add Your SSH Key: Copy your SSH key to the
~/.ssh/authorized_keys
file on your Raspberry Pi. - Connect to RemoteIoT: Use the RemoteIoT client to connect to your Raspberry Pi using the SSH key you just added.
With these steps, you’re all set to start managing your Raspberry Pi remotely. It’s like having a remote control for your IoT devices!

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them
As with any technology, you might encounter a few bumps along the way. Here are some common challenges and how to tackle them:
Connection Issues
If you’re having trouble connecting to your Raspberry Pi, make sure:
- Your SSH key is correctly added to the authorized_keys file.
- Your Raspberry Pi is connected to the internet.
- Firewall settings aren’t blocking the connection.
Security Concerns
Security is paramount when managing devices remotely. To enhance security:
- Use strong, unique passphrases for your SSH keys.
- Regularly update your Raspberry Pi’s software.
- Monitor login attempts and block suspicious activity.
